Coconut shell charcoal is valued throughout the world. This is caused by an aromatic quality that gives a warm fragrance when found in a wood stove. Furthermore, this high-quality charcoal has applications in many different industries. Activated charcoals is essential to cleaning and marinating toxic chemicals and the production of explosives. Also, it is used during this process of refining gold.

Developing a Coconut Shell Charcoal Making Machine
All you will have to develop a high-production charcoal plant is definitely an average 55-gallon barrel. Stand it upright and visually separate the barrel into three sections hereafter called the top, middle and bottom sections.
The method works on controlling the volume of air which is allowed in the kiln, so create around 6 1.5” holes in each section or perhaps a total of 18 holes evenly spaced across the entire barrel. It is vital that you can open and close these holes. The very best middle and bottom section ought to be closed and opened independently of your other sections.
The top of the the drum will require a lid featuring a powerful chimney or smoke stack. The skill sets in the local blacksmith will be invaluable in creating and ultra-practical and uber-convenient charcoal making machine, but not entirely necessary. Making Use Of Your Coconut Shell Charcoal Making Machine
This kiln is capable of converting large amounts of raw coconut shells into charcoal daily. This is the way it operates:
Fill the base section of the barrel with coconut shells and set them inside a funnel shape using the lowest point at the centre of the barrel. Soak a couple of pieces in kerosene or lighter fuel (kerosene works better) and set up them ablaze.
After the fire has begun in the bottom section, pile on more coconut shells filling the center and top sections. You will see flames visible with the bottom pair of holes, so shut the holes to the top level and middle sections.
As being the process continues, the shells will shrink and sink on the bottom. Ensure you are continuously adding more shells to the barrel to help keep it full. After you spot the telltale symbol of glowing coals visible with the bottom holes, your charcoal within this section is prepared. Close the holes towards the bottom layer and open the people in between and top sections and put the best and chimney in your barrel. As the glow moves upwards to the middle section, close the holes here too. After the top section is glowing all holes should be covered and the product permitted to cool for roughly 8 hours. It is crucial that the fire is killed cold out of your introduction of air once you open the charcoal kiln furnace will ignite the fuel quickly and you will probably lose your merchandise.
